"the bic memorial" by shortandpretentious

A number of pens
sit in a coffee cup
on my desk
in my room.
Most of them don't work
and as I find the dead ones,
whose service to the author is finished,
I throw them away.

The blue pen I hold now
works,
but in a matter of time
it will wind up with the others

immortalized here
